Output 8e0c9a2991691da3479cf55b132631791a84e4ffbbefb7933aa6336cb2ba4bef:142

value
2695071
script pubkey
OP_0 OP_PUSHBYTES_20 dab596f83f4a7b9ddd9b5f439127ec3542492e69
address
bc1qm26ed7plffaemhvmtapezflvx4pyjtnf5xu502
transaction
8e0c9a2991691da3479cf55b132631791a84e4ffbbefb7933aa6336cb2ba4bef